Transaction 57613ddc2110261b886c5ea90e33ea23d06672cb1b898c7314d2afd98f2edfa8

1 Input
2 Outputs
  • 57613ddc2110261b886c5ea90e33ea23d06672cb1b898c7314d2afd98f2edfa8:0
  • value  26690000
    address  1y58dEhsrGmyjfashokiPyrrY8EP9sobv
  • 57613ddc2110261b886c5ea90e33ea23d06672cb1b898c7314d2afd98f2edfa8:1
  • value  1647790
    address  1ByHCPaVDtToNu152m1FyGSH9CRVAegBXY